Graulhet

Graulhet (French pronunciation: [ɡʁojɛ]) is a commune in the Tarn department in southern France.

Leather was the main activity before this industry largely relocated to China.

Graulhet is crossed by the river Dadou.

Graulhet is also one of the last remaining places in the Midi where Mesturets are made traditionally.
